An Executive Certificate in Music Research provides professionals with advanced skills in music analysis, research methodologies, and data interpretation. This program equips participants with the tools to conduct independent research projects and contribute meaningfully to the field.
Learning outcomes for this Executive Certificate in Music Research include mastering qualitative and quantitative research techniques applicable to music studies, enhancing critical thinking skills through analysis of music theory and history, and developing proficiency in presenting research findings effectively through written reports and presentations. Students will also improve their understanding of scholarly publishing within music research.
The duration of the Executive Certificate in Music Research is typically flexible, catering to working professionals. Many programs offer a part-time option, allowing for completion within 12-18 months. However, this can vary based on the institution and course load.
This certificate holds significant industry relevance for music scholars, music industry professionals, librarians, archivists, and anyone seeking to enhance their expertise in music-related research. Graduates gain valuable skills applicable to academic settings, music publishing, arts administration, and various roles within the creative industries. The program fosters strong analytical skills and research capabilities highly valued across multiple sectors.
